Block wall rep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ity of masonry walls constructed from concrete blocks, bricks, or stone. These services typically involve assessing the damaged or deteriorated sections of the wall, removing any compromised materials, and performing necessary repairs such as replacing broken or crumbling blocks, sealing cracks, and reinforcing weakened areas. Skilled contractors may also apply protective coatings or sealants to prevent future damage and extend the lifespan of the wall. Proper repair ensures that the wall continues to serve its intended function, whether for privacy, security, or aesthetic purposes.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for block wall repair typically ranges from $10 to $25 per square foot. For example, repairing a 100-square-foot section may cost between $1,000 and $2,500 in materials alone. Variations depend on block type and repair complexity.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for block wall repairs us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our. A standard repair job might take 4 to 8 hours, resulting in total labor charges from $200 to $800. Larger or more intricate projects may increase these costs.
Overall Project Costs - Complete block wall repair projects often range from $500 to $3,000, depending on size and extent of damage.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ive rebuilding can approach the higher end of the range. Costs vary based on project specifics and local rates.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as permits, debris removal, or reinforcement can add $100 to $500 or more. These expenses depend on project requirements and local regulations, influencing the final price of repair services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my block wall needs repair? Signs such as cracking, shifting, or bulging blocks can indicate the need for repair. A local contractor can assess the wall's condition and recommend appropriate solutions.
What causes damage to block walls? Common causes include soil pressure, moisture infiltration, poor initial construction, or settling of the foundation. A professional can identify the underlying issues.
What types of repairs are available for block walls? Repairs may involve repointing mortar joints, replacing damaged blocks, or reinforcing the structure. Local service providers can determine the best approach for each situation.
How long does block wall repair typically take? Repair duration varies based on the extent of damage, but a local contractor can provide an estimated timeline after inspection.
Is it necessary to replace an entire block wall if it’s damaged? Not always; many issues can be fixed with targeted repairs. A professional assessment can clarify whether repair or replacement is appropriate.
